A Clare surfer has died following an accident on Monday morning.

An alarm was raised shortly after 8am when the man got into difficulty while surfing at Lough Donnell in Quilty.

In a statement, The Irish Coast Guard outlined, “The Shannon based Coast Guard helicopter R115 this morning transferred a man to University Hospital Limerick”. CPR was administered on scene and also en route to the hospital.

Members of the Kilkee unit of the Irish Coast Guard were at the scene along with An Garda Síochána.

Family members of the local surfer who is from Mid-Clare and also works as a lifeguard were contacted to come to UHL shortly after he was airlifted there.

He was pronounced dead at UHL shortly before lunchtime.
